Book Review: Collecting Tears – Tomoiya’s Story by C.A. King

Title: Collecting Tears – Tomoiya’s Story

Author: C.A. King

Rating: 4/5

Synopsis:

A Vampire Tale

She had everything, including a secret…
But she wasn’t the only one with something to hide.

Graduation as co-valedictorian of her high school class, along with her best friend Moira, was icing on the cake. There was no doubt: Tomoiya, a princess of a wealthy kingdom, was born for greatness. She had everything: intelligence; good looks; popularity; and a secret. Not even her closest friends were allowed to know she was a vampire.

One night was all it took to change everything. When celebrations turned deadly, Tomoiya was forced to come face-to-face with the realization she wasn’t the only one amongst her peers with something to hide. 

Tomoiya’s stuck asking if she can ever trust anyone again, and there is nobody to answer except herself.

Review:

I have read numerous works by C.A. King, but her new take on vampires in Collecting Tears: Tomoiya’s Story is one of my favorites.  I first read Tomoiya’s Story: Escape to Darkness a few months ago, and I couldn’t wait to start reading this next book in the series.

I am always amazed by authors who take fantasy and mythology and make it modern, and King’s specialty is just that.  With this novel, she took vampire mythology and made it modern to connect with today’s teens.  I find King’s novels to be contemporary young adult novels for those who prefer living in fantasy, and I wish that she had been around when I was a teenager.  Her work is so passionate, and I find her writing to be comforting.  King’s take on teenage emotions and experiences is impeccable, and I love how well she connects with today’s youth as an adult writer.

Tomoiya is one of my favorite characters in literature due to King’s crystal clear descriptions of her and her story.  Tomoiya came alive for me, and I loved being able to spend time with her as I read.  Tomoiya is a character who has flaws and comes alive for the reader due to her imperfections.  King creates characters that feel as though they are real people, and even though part of this novel is fantasy, all of the events are believable.  King brings to life a thrilling story of a girl trying to live a normal life while hiding a secret, just to realize that she isn’t the only one.  The twists and turns in Collecting Tears: Tomoiya’s Story were magnificent, and despite how short this novel is, it packed quite a punch.

If you are a fan of vampire tales with a twist, as well as intriguing thrillers, then you won’t want to miss this novel!  King’s work is perfect for young adults and adults alike who enjoy escaping into fantasy, and I have found such comfort in her work.
